Asthma symptoms include difficulty breathing, wheezing, coughing tightness in the chest. In severe cases, asthma can be deadly.

 

According to the Asthma and Allergy Foundation of America (AAFA), asthma is characterized by inflammation of the air passages resulting in the temporary narrowing of the airways that transport air from the nose and mouth to the lungs. Asthma symptoms can be caused by allergens or irritants that are inhaled into the lungs, resulting in inflamed, clogged and constricted airways.

The Comfort Suites hotel in Grantville, PA is dealing with an outbreak of Legionnaires' disease. Hotel guests may have come down with a case of the disease which has led to an investigation of the hotel.  

 

Guests who stayed at the Comfort Suites hotel in Grantville have contracted Legionnaires' disease. Recent hotels guests have been notified as an ongoing investigation takes place. It is unclear how many guests have been affected so far.  

 

The Pennsylvania Department of Health and the Pennsylvania Department of Environmental Protection are leading the investigation.

Quebec City's large Legionnaires' disease outbreak appears to be under control, the city's public health director said Friday.  

 

Dr. Francois Desbiens said measures the city's public health department have taken to ensure cooling towers in the outbreak zone have been cleaned and disinfected appear to be bearing fruit.

Police and other first responders may be exposed during busts of illegal marijuana- growing operations to dangerous levels of mold that could lead to potentially deadly respiratory diseases, researchers said Monday.
